For a second year, Queen's University has contributed to a Fringe Event jointly hosted with the Northern Ireland Chamber of Commerce. This is an important lobbying opportunity allows NI businesses and Queen's to showcase our impact at a UK wide level.

Our Vice-President (Governance and External Affairs) and Registrar, Dr Ryan Feeney, took part in a panel discussion highlighting how our University's research and innovation can enhance the Labour Government's policy aims. 

With key politicians, policy makers and lobbyists in attendance, the event demonstrated how Northern Ireland and Queen's University can be a partner in delivering policy goals.
